Accountants' body welcomes Personal Insolvency Bill

Publication of the Personal Insolvency Bill 2012 today was welcomed by Chartered Accountants Ireland (CAI), with the professional body describing the legislation as a step which can help many people currently enduring economic hardship as a result of the financial crisis.

However CAI warned that anyone who seeks to enter into one of these settlements should be aware of the significant procedural and information challenges that they will need to address in order to avail of the new options.
